
Svetlana Kolesnichenko and Alexandra Patskevich of Russia perform during the Women Duet Technical preliminary of Synchronized Swimming at the 17th FINA World Championships held in Budapest, Hungary on July 14, 2017. (Xinhua/Attila Volgyi)
Svetlana Kolesnichenko and Alexandra Patskevich of Russia perform during the Women Duet Technical preliminary of Synchronized Swimming at the 17th FINA World Championships held in Budapest, Hungary on July 14, 2017. (Xinhua/Attila Volgyi)